I have a Cisco Aironet 1142 that keeps having issues with DotRadio0 going to a reset state. If I reload it seems to function for awhile and then it happens again shortly there after.
Apr 17 18:08:24.619: %LINK-5-CHANGED: Interface Dot11Radio0, changed state to reset
Apr 17 18:08:25.619: %LINEPROTO-5-UPDOWN: Line protocol on Interface Dot11Radio0, changed state to down

Josh:
You are using 40 MHz channel width on radio 0 (2.4 GHz).
That will interfere with APs around for sure.
remove the command:
channel width 40-above
from under radio 0. that will probably eliminate most of the interference and hopefully will solve the issue.
